Transaction 60767698299cf827bf373ad381fa434c4259d29f41cafd5712cc3a006f59957e
1 Input
2 Outputs
- 60767698299cf827bf373ad381fa434c4259d29f41cafd5712cc3a006f59957e:0
- 60767698299cf827bf373ad381fa434c4259d29f41cafd5712cc3a006f59957e:1
value 55176
address 15i22QG5TUzvgCJc9EyHUgpVMWqYSapWWK
value 6065621
address 13cPL9jhmhuVMvBubaTVXE3g1LhuGzj94p